Pi Coin price has shown signs of a short-term recovery following recent weakness, posting modest gains as buying interest gradually returns. Despite this improvement, the broader market environment remains cautious, and technical indicators suggest that the recent upward movement may be corrective rather than the start of a sustained bullish trend. As a result, Pi Coin could remain vulnerable to renewed downside pressure if momentum weakens.
From a technical perspective, Pi Coin is currently displaying a hidden bearish divergence, which often appears during corrective rallies within a broader downtrend. Between December 19 and January 3, the price formed a lower high while the Relative Strength Index printed a higher high. This divergence indicates that the recent price increase lacks strong underlying support and that selling pressure may still dominate beneath the surface. While short-term sentiment has improved, this setup suggests the prevailing bearish trend could resume once temporary buying interest fades.
On the macro side, indicators present a more balanced outlook. The Chaikin Money Flow has moved above the zero line and reached a near-monthly high, signaling improving capital inflows. Since CMF measures volume-weighted money movement, its rise suggests accumulation rather than short-lived speculative activity. This steady inflow of capital has helped Pi Coin maintain price stability and avoid deeper losses, offering a short-term cushion against broader crypto market volatility.
However, Pi Coin price continues to face a key resistance near $0.214, a level that aligns closely with the 23.6% Fibonacci retracement. Multiple rejections around this zone highlight persistent selling pressure, making it a critical barrier for bulls. A sustained close above $0.214 could confirm a breakout and open the door for a move toward $0.226, especially if trading volume and market sentiment improve.
If bullish momentum fails to hold, downside risks remain significant. A break below $0.207 could accelerate selling pressure and push Pi Coin toward the $0.199 support level. Failure to defend this area would reinforce the broader bearish outlook and increase the likelihood of further declines in the near term.
